At home as the Sabbath day arrives, look at the holiness engendered;

Before the setting of the sun let all secular work be laid aside and all secular papers be put out of sight. Parents, explain your work and its purpose to your children, and let them share in your preparation to keep the Sabbath according to the commandment.  {6T 355.3}

The sun is not yet set and we can say to the children, come let us have worship.  Let them feel the relish that we as parents can have for the Sabbath.  Let them feel a special moment around the family altar.

Then around the family altar all should wait to welcome God’s holy day, as they would watch for the coming of a dear friend.  {ST, May 25, 1882 par. 9}

From the very cradle the children are to be educated, and right impressions given to their mind. They are to be instructed in regard to the knowledge of God and His holy commandments. The first lessons impressed upon the child are never forgotten.  {BEcho, February 13, 1899 par. 5}

While my parents were not very careful about not bringing the Sabbath right before sunset, we had worship around the family table and there was something I looked forward to every week.  It was something that imprinted itself upon my mind.

Then search the Scriptures, parents. Be not only hearers, be doers of the word. Meet God’s standard in the education of your children. Let them see that you are preparing for the Sabbath on the working days of the week. All preparations should be made, every stitch taken in the six working days; all cooking for the Sabbath should be done on the preparation day. It is possible to do this; and if you make it a rule you can do it.  {BEcho, February 13, 1899 par. 6}

I remember my mother cooking the food and wrapping it with a special sense of sacredness wrapping it up in a thick quilt to keep it hot for the next day.  It had an impression and this is an impression on the children.

Lead your children to consider the Sabbath as a delight, the day of days, the holy of the Lord, honourable. Do not allow yourself to spend the precious hours of the Sabbath in your bed. The heads of the house should be astir early. On Friday the clothing of the children, looked after during the week, should be all laid out by their own hands under the direction of the mother, so that they can dress quietly, without any confusion, or rushing about, and hasty speeches.  {BEcho, February 13, 1899 par. 8}

If you do this with your children telling them this is your Sabbath suit and put it ready before sunset, the next day the clothes are all ready to put on.

In the morning the family should gather about the table quietly; and it would be well if on the Sabbath there should ever be a simple, palatable meal, yet something that would be considered a treat, all prepared–something that they do not have every day of the week.  {BEcho, February 13, 1899 par. 9}

If you have something special on the day it adds to the festivity.

Then either before or after the meal should come the family worship. This should be a service in which the children could all take a part. All should have their Bibles, each reading a verse or two. Then a simple hymn may be sung, followed, not by a long, wearisome prayer, but a simple petition, telling the Lord in the simplest manner their needs, and expressing their gratitude for God’s mercies and blessings.  {BEcho, February 13, 1899 par. 9}     On the Sabbath, parents should give all the time they can to their children, that they may make it a delight..  {BEcho, February 13, 1899 par. 10}
